MarÃa Isabel Rivera Torres is a Spanish actress from the autonomous region of Galicia.
She was born in the City and Naval Station of El Ferrol, in Galicia, North-western Spain. Though she started her career as an actress in the 1980s, it was not until the her lead actress role in the Oscar winning Best Foreign Language Film 2004 The Sea Inside that she received broad recognition.
She is fluent in Galician, Spanish, and Catalan, regional languages of Spain. She also speaks English and French with varying degrees of fluency.
|